Date-Template für textbasierte Datumsangaben

Philips Hue 7146060PU Go LED Leuchte, tragbares, kabelloses Licht, dimmbar, bis zu 16 Millionen Farben, stuerbar via App, kompatibel mit Amazon Alexa, EU-Stecker (Echo, Echo Dot)
Philips Hue 7146060PU Go LED Leuchte, tragbares, kabelloses Licht, dimmbar, bis zu 16 Millionen Farben, stuerbar via App, kompatibel mit Amazon Alexa, EU-Stecker (Echo, Echo Dot)
--

In manchen Fällen ist es schöner, wenn man die Datumsangabe etwas anders gestalten kann.

Hierfür bieten sich Templates an.

{% set midnight = now().replace(hour=0, minute=0, second=0, microsecond=0).timestamp() %}
{% set event = states('sensor.uptime') | as_timestamp %}
{% set delta = ((event - midnight) // 86400) | int %}
{% if delta < 0 %}
 {{ -delta }} Tage her
{% elif delta == 0 %}
 Heute!
{% elif delta == 1 %}
 Morgen
{% else %}
 In {{ delta }} Tagen
{% endif %}
ein Code-Beispiel mit sennsor.uptime
ein Code-Beispiel mit sennsor.fritz_box_7530_ui_device_uptime